Hawkesbury River Oyster Shed, Hawkesbury
Located in the heart of Hawkesbury River, the River Oyster Shed is a small local oyster farm supplying produce straight from the source! The team are also committed towards being environmentally friendly, with oyster shells saved for either fish farms or returned back to nature.
